EDWARDS, Judge.
Defendant was convicted and sentenced for aggravated rape and aggravated burglary. He did not appeal timely. Later, counsel filed a motion for an "out-of-time" appeal, alleging solely that defendant had only recently informed his office of his desire to appeal.
